WebTuberculin PPD is indicated as an aid in the detection of infection with . Mycobacterium tuberculosis. 4.2 DOSE AND METHOD OF ADMINISTRATION . Dose . The Mantoux test is performed by injection intradermally, with a syringe and needle, 0.1 mL of Tuberculin PPD. Web15 jul. 2024 · U40 stands for: 40 Units of insulin per 1mL (milliliter) U100 stands for: 100 Units of insulin per 1mL (milliliter) U500 stands for: 500 Units of insulin per 1mL (milliliter) So, if you have a U100 insulin product, and you need to inject 50 units, that would come out to 0.5 mL.
